Description of palatal height in Balinese dentistry students of Mahasaraswati Denpasar University

Keywords: Korkhaus index, palatal height, Camila measurement method

Abstract

Background: In removable orthodontic treatment, it is also necessary to consider the retention and stability, including the height of the palate. Objective: To determine the description of the palate height in the Balinese people with the measurement method of Camila, et al. Methods: This study used an analytic observational design with a cross sectional approach. The study was conducted in Faculty of Dentistry, Mahasaraswati University Denpasar with purposive sampling technique based on inclusion criteria. The samples were dental students of batch 2017-2019 who are Balinese. Analysis of the data through the stages of nor-mality test using Kolmogorov-Smirnov, homogeneity test using Levene test, and descriptive test using Mann-Whitney U test. Results: Palatal height index of Balinese males was an average of 38.93±6.27 and females with an average of 35.05±7.10. Based on the comparative test, it was concluded that there was no significant difference in palatal height for males and females.
